India’s External Affairs Minister S Jaishankar visited Bhutan for two days.

He met Bhutanese Foreign Minister D N Dhungyel in Bumthang.

They talked about how India and Bhutan can work together on development, energy, trade and travel links.

They also discussed culture and connections between their people.

Jaishankar opened a new 65-bed hospital for mothers and children in Mongar.

He also opened a bridge in Samdrup Jongkhar to improve connections in eastern Bhutan.

In Gasa, he helped begin a 500 KW hydropower project.

The visit was intended to strengthen the friendly relationship between India and Bhutan.

Key facts

Visit duration
Two days
Main meeting
S Jaishankar met D N Dhungyel in Bumthang
Hospital
A 65-bed Gyaltsuen Jetsun Pema Mother and Child Hospital was inaugurated in Mongar
Bridge
The Jaganathan Bridge in Samdrup Jongkhar was inaugurated under Project Dantak
Hydropower project
The foundation stone was laid for the 500 KW Lunana Hydropower Project in Gasa
Discussion areas
Development partnership, energy, trade, connectivity, culture and people-to-people ties
Planned meetings
Jaishankar was also scheduled to call on King Jigme Khesar Namgyel Wangchuck and Prime Minister Tshering Tobgay
